Você já se perguntou como a evolução do Java está adaptando suas funcionalidades de segurança para atender às demandas modernas de aplicativos e infraestrutura? 🤔 A JEP 411 marca um ponto de virada significativo, refletindo uma abordagem modernizada para a segurança.
Neste artigo, vamos mergulhar no que a obsolescência do Security Manager significa para o desenvolvimento Java atual e futuro. 🚀
Introdução à Mudança
O lançamento do Java 17 traz consigo a JEP 411, um marco significativo que propõe a depreciação do Security Manager, um componente histórico da segurança Java, para remoção em versões futuras. Este movimento não apenas reflete a evolução tecnológica, mas também uma resposta às necessidades emergentes de segurança em ambientes de aplicativos modernos.
O Adeus ao Security Manager
O Security Manager tem sido a espinha dorsal da segurança Java, oferecendo uma camada de controle fino sobre as operações críticas. No entanto, a JEP 411 sinaliza uma mudança de paradigma, reconhecendo que o gerenciamento de segurança moderno demanda flexibilidade e integração além do que o Security Manager pode oferecer.
Adaptação às Práticas Modernas de Segurança
A decisão de depreciar o Security Manager é uma adaptação às práticas contemporâneas de segurança, que são gerenciadas em múltiplos níveis - desde a rede até a aplicação. A mudança alinha o Java com abordagens de segurança mais holísticas e distribuídas, indicando a direção futura da segurança na plataforma.
Explorando Novas Abordagens para Segurança
Com a JEP 411, os desenvolvedores são incentivados a adotar novos métodos para assegurar suas aplicações. Isso inclui a implementação de controles de acesso baseados em API, aproveitando recursos de segurança do sistema operacional e da nuvem, e integrando práticas de segurança no ciclo de vida do desenvolvimento de software - um reflexo da filosofia DevSecOps.
Benefícios da Transição
A transição para novas práticas de segurança promete aplicações mais seguras, flexíveis e adaptáveis. Além disso, a integração de mecanismos de segurança específicos para o contexto em aplicações e infraestruturas modernas oferece uma proteção mais granular e eficaz.
Preparando-se para o Futuro
A depreciação do Security Manager requer que desenvolvedores e arquitetos de software modernizem suas estratégias de segurança. Este processo de adaptação, embora desafiador, é uma oportunidade para melhorar a segurança das aplicações e alinhá-las com as necessidades atuais e futuras do mercado.
Perguntas Frequentes
O que é a JEP 411?
A JEP 411 propõe marcar o Security Manager do Java como obsoleto, sinalizando sua remoção em versões futuras do Java, e realinhando as práticas de segurança com as tendências atuais.
Por que o Security Manager está sendo depreciado?
Com o avanço das práticas de segurança e a evolução dos ambientes de execução, o Security Manager já não se encaixa bem no ecossistema moderno, levando à necessidade de métodos de segurança mais adaptáveis e integrados.
Como isso afeta o desenvolvimento Java?
A depreciação sinaliza aos desenvolvedores a necessidade de transição para novas práticas de segurança, encorajando a adoção de alternativas modernas que são mais adequadas para a arquitetura atual de aplicações e infraestrutura.
Conclusão: Um Novo Capítulo para a Segurança Java
A JEP 411 é um convite para reinventar a segurança no ecossistema Java, mantendo a plataforma no centro da inovação tecnológica e da segurança de aplicações. O Java 17, com suas mudanças, guia os desenvolvedores através desta nova era, assegurando que a plataforma continue relevante e preparada para os desafios futuros em segurança de software.